Voting alignment

Steve Darling and Sir Christopher Chope voted the same way 77% of the time, based on 184 shared comparable votes.

142 same votes 42 different votes 184 shared votes

Alignment only includes divisions where both MPs recorded an Aye or No vote. Tellers, absences, abstentions, and missing votes are excluded.
